fascinating historical period Akhenatens Religious Revolution Atenism and its Impact 2 Akhenatens radical religious reforms centered on the Aten the solar disc which he elevated to the status of supreme deity effectively dismantling the traditional polytheistic system This shift known as Atenism involved a profound change in religious practices iconography and the very structure of Egyptian further insights into the complexities of this religious revolution Nefertiti Queen Coregent or Something More Nefertitis role in the Amarna court remains a topic of ongoing debate While traditionally viewed as the pharaohs wife growing evidence suggests she held significant political influence possibly even coruling alongside Akhenaten The famous Nefertiti bust in Berlin along with other depictions of her in royal attire signifies her elevated status Some interpretations of inscriptions and artifacts propose that she may have even succeeded Akhenaten as pharaoh under the name Neferneferuaten although this theory remains highly debated Cite specific scholarly articles or books arguing for and against Nefertitis co regency The Amarna Art Style A Radical Departure The art of the Amarna period is distinctly unique characterized by elongated figures expressive features and a naturalistic almost impressionistic style This stark contrast to the conventional rigid formality of earlier Egyptian art reflects the revolutionary changes occurring within society Experts like mention a prominent Egyptologist specializing in Amarna art highlight the intentional use of these the royal couple The Fall of Amarna and the Return to Tradition The Amarna period was relatively shortlived ending with the death of Akhenaten and the subsequent restoration of traditional religious practices The reasons for this are multifaceted and still under investigation The lack of widespread popular support for Atenism coupled with the weakening of the central authority and the potential for internal political strife likely contributed to its demise The return to Thebes and the reinstatement of traditional gods signified a turning point in Egyptian history marking the end of this
